Walmart: 1,500 jobs cut

May 21, 2025USRetailWalmart

Walmart eliminated 1,500 corporate positions in Bentonville, Hoboken and other tech hubs while simultaneously investing over $500 million in AI and robotics. Over 50% of fulfillment center volume now comes from automation. There is strong evidence linking these cuts to AI adoption, with company leadership referencing automation and efficiency gains in public statements. Of the 1,500 total positions affected, our methodology estimates that approximately 1,125 roles (75%) are attributable to AI-driven changes. This is part of a broader pattern in Retail where companies are restructuring operations around AI capabilities while reducing headcount in functions susceptible to automation.
